Rajar’s Q2 radio listening figures provide a rosy outlook for the commercial sector. After falling behind in Q1, commercial radio has beaten the BBC in terms of listening, with 35.57 million listeners (vs. 35.07 for BBC stations). Facebook to suppress clickbait stories
Facebook has ramped up its crackdown on so-called clickbait news that appears on the social network. Carrying intriguing and misleading headlines, these articles are solely designed to lure consumers into clicking.
